Summary The District Munsif Court, Uthukuli convicted 20-year-old Vijay under Section 4-A of the Tamil Nadu Prohibition Act for consuming liquor in a public place near Thimmanayakkanpalayam Railway Bridge on February 1, 2026. The court found the prosecution's evidence, including the Head Constable's testimony and seizure of a 180ml brandy bottle and tumbler, credible and sufficient to prove the offense beyond reasonable doubt. Vijay was sentenced to pay ₹1,000 fine or face one week simple imprisonment in default. This case analysis is maintained by casestatus.in based on publicly available court records.
